In 2020-2021, 54,635 people earned their degree in English language and literature, making the major the 18th most popular in the United States. In 2019-2020, English language and literature graduates who were awarded their degree in 2017-2019, earned an average of $30,352 and had an average of $23,972 in loans still to pay off.

Across the Far Western US region, there were 9,578 English language and literature graduates with average earnings and debt of $30,183 and $20,720 respectively. At the bachelor’s degree level specifically, there were 5,860 English language and literature graduates with average earnings and debt of $39,720 and $23,024 respectively.
